Sébastien Lecornu Reappointed French Prime Minister Amidst Political Turmoil

- 🇫🇷 President Emmanuel Macron has surprisingly reappointed Sébastien Lecornu as the French prime minister, just four days after his initial resignation.
- 💡 This decision came late Friday, following extensive talks between Macron and various political party leaders.
Lecornu's Previous Role and Resignation
- 🏛️ Lecornu was initially nominated to help navigate France's political system through its current challenges.
- 📉 His first government, formed last Sunday, collapsed overnight, leading to his resignation on Monday morning.
- 🗣️ Lecornu had publicly stated just two days prior that he was not actively seeking the position and felt his mission was complete.
The Challenge Ahead
- 🎯 Lecornu's monumental task now is to forge some form of consensus or a non-aggression pact with parliamentary parties.
- 📈 The primary goal is to enable the government to pass essential legislation, such as next year's budget, which is inherently controversial.
- ⚠️ The odds of this newly formed government achieving longevity are considered not particularly good due to the fractured parliamentary landscape.
